It’s just not the problem with story. Even the most boring story can be watchable if it’s well presented.
1. Actors loosely bind to their roles. Their acting is plastic coated. Stiff body language, unnatural accent, overdramatic dialogue delivery and so on.
2. Screenplay is shit. Writers are underpaid. Good stories die due to poor screenplay.
3. Casting (couch) is shit because most producers cherrypick the actors or even cast themselves.
4. Small market for commercial movies. No point in risking the investment.
5. Audience have other platforms/options to watch better quality movies.
